## Onboarding: GC Pauses in Matchwright

Matchwright, our order-matching service, occasionally suffers garbage-collection pauses exceeding 400ms, which trips the upstream latency alarms you will be paged for. Before escalating, check the Heapwatch dashboard to confirm the pause correlates with a full collection rather than network jitter. You can pull raw GC telemetry directly from the Heapwatch ingestion endpoint, which requires authentication as the on-call service identity. Authenticate your queries using the on-call key listed below.

service key, tadup-tahog: zpat7_wB1tnEL

## Ownership — Versioning Policy

The Plinth shared component library follows strict semver. Breaking changes to any exported component require a major bump, a migration note in MIGRATIONS.md, and a two-week deprecation window announced at the eng sync. Minor and patch releases ship every Thursday via the release pipeline; no manual tags, ever. Consumers pin to minor versions, so unannounced majors will break at least four product teams. Version decisions, release approvals, and exceptions to this policy all route through a single owner.

named custodian: Oliath Ralax

# The Garrow Street garage pushes occupancy counts to the Lotwise
# ingest endpoint every few seconds. Counts drift when the gate
# sensors double-fire, so we smooth readings and clamp deltas before
# publishing to the city dashboard. If you change anything here, rerun
# the replay harness against last week's feed. The constants below
# control the smoothing window and clamp thresholds.

tuning table, yajog-yahof:
BUDGETS = {
    "lamvan": 303,
    "wenox": 460,
    "fenvan": 525,
}

**Q: What happens when Mailcull marks a bounce as permanent?**

Mailcull, our email bounce processor, classifies hard bounces after three consecutive failures and suppresses the address automatically. Soft bounces are retried for 72 hours. If the suppression list itself becomes corrupted, restore it from the encrypted nightly snapshot in the Thornfield backup bucket. Restoring requires the team recovery passphrase, which is kept directly below this entry for emergencies.

unlock words, kahof-bahap: praax-ulaix